Instrução ng-disabled do AngularJS
Definição e uso
ng-disabled
A instrução define a propriedade disabled do campo do formulário (input, select ou textarea).
Se ng-disabled
Se a expressão na propriedade retornar true, o campo do formulário será desativado.
ng-disabled
A instrução é necessária para valores que podem alternar entre true e false. No HTML, você não pode definir a propriedade disabled como false (a existência da propriedade disabled desativa o elemento, independentemente de seu valor).
Exemplo
Desativar/Ativar campo de entrada:
Desativar campo de formulário: <input type="checkbox" ng-model="all"> <br> <input type="text" ng-disabled="all"> <input type="radio" ng-disabled="all"> <select ng-disabled="all"> <option>Mulher</option> <option>Homem</option> </select>
Sintaxe
<input ng-disabled="expressão</input>
Sujeito a <input>
、<select>
e <textarea>
Elementos suportados.
Parâmetros
Parâmetros | Descrição |
---|---|
expressão | Se retornar true, a expressão do atributo disabled do elemento será configurada. |